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Lake Creek, is a h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 71.1°F (21.7°C) and 88.5°F (31.4°C).

Temperature

The shift into June is characterized by a subtle rise in the average high-temperature, transitioning from May's moderately hot 79.7°F (26.5°C) to a tropical 88.5°F (31.4°C). Lake Creek experiences a steady low-temperature of 71.1°F (21.7°C) throughout June.

Heat index

June's average heat index is calculated to be an extremely hot 104°F (40°C). Implement additional cautionary meas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could occur. Prolonged activity might induce heatstroke.
From a standpoint of the heat index, values pertain to shaded conditions and mild breezes. Direct sunlight can cause a surge in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'felt air temperature', stands as a testimony to how temperature and humidity combine to impact our sense of warmth. Additional elements including metabolic differences, the level of physical activity, and attire have a role in shaping the individual's temperature perception. It is noteworthy to mention that direct sunlight exposure can augment the felt temperature, le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are quite important for babies and toddlers. Kids generally face higher risks than adults as they sweat less. Along with their large skin surface compared to their small bodies and higher heat production due to their activities, their vulnerability is increased.
Humans rely on perspiration as a cooling mechanism, wherein the evaporating sweat counteracts excessive warmth. With high air temperature and humidity (high heat index) conditions, sweat production is restricted, leading to an amplified perception of heat. When body temperature rises due to excess heat gain beyond its removal capability, one might experience heat-related disorders.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in June is 75%.

Rainfall

In Lake Creek, in June, it is raining for 12.8 days, with typically 2.95" (75m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Lake Creek, during the entire year, the rain falls for 150.3 days and collects up to 35.31" (897m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Lake Creek, snow does not fall in April through October and December.

Daylight

The month with the longest days is June, with an average of 14h and 18min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:13 am and sunset at 8:27 pm. On the last day of June, sunrise is at 6:16 am and sunset at 8:36 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in June in Lake Creek is 10.2h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: The average daily UV index of 7 in June transforms into the following instructions:
Fend off overexposure. Sun protection is vital. The Sun's UV radiation is at its strongest between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Minimize direct exposure to the sun during this period. Sun-related eye harm can be minimized with proper sunglasses offering UVA and UVB coverage.
